MATLAB冲浪meshgrid问题 - 2个向量1矩阵 - 表面图(MATLAB surf me

2019-10-19 10:13发布

我有2个向量和矩阵一个,我想作一个表面图。

  1. 第一向量A,距离矢量A = 1:1:100(大小1 100);
  2. 第二矢量B,时间矢量B = 1:1:10(尺寸10);
  3. 矩阵C,每列具有对于B的每个值的数据(大小100 10)

我怎么能使用meshgrid和/或用于获取表面三维图的冲浪功能?

Answer 1:

[AA, BB] = ndgrid(A,B);
surf(BB,AA,C)

或者使用的版本surf ,让两个向量作为它的两个第一输入:

surf(B,A,C)

其中为特定的载体( [1 2 ...]可以被简化为单输入版本

surf(C)


文章来源: MATLAB surf meshgrid issue - 2 vectors 1 matrix - surface plot
标签: matlab plot mesh